Hamburg/Weissenhaus, June 4, 2026 — The fifth qualifying place for the 2027 FIDE Freestyle Chess World Championship will be decided earlier than planned. Organizers said Thursday that the leaders of the Open and Women’s overall standings in the Freestyle Friday series after the final June 26 event will each secure a direct berth.

FIDE Freestyle Chess Championship Qualifiers

Each championship field will feature eight players. Four contenders have already qualified in the Open division: Magnus Carlsen, Fabiano Caruana, Nodirbek Abdusattorov, and Vincent Keymer. Four players are also through in the Women’s division: Bibisara Assaubayeva, Harika Dronavalli, Alua Nurman, and Dinara Wagner. The finals are scheduled for February 2027 at the Weissenhaus Private Nature Luxury Resort in northern Germany.

Players will keep all points earned so far in the Freestyle Friday Championship and can continue to chase additional spots when the series resumes after the summer break. The second half of the Freestyle Friday Championship will run from early October through mid-December 2026 and will determine the sixth qualifier in both the Open and Women’s fields.

Organizers said the format changes accommodate a crowded tournament calendar and are intended to add momentum to the lead-up to the 2027 finals.
